About the Provider

Petaluma, California-based transformational learning platform founded in 2010 that has engaged over 3.5 million people across 180 countries, featuring teachers and thought leaders in spirituality, holistic health, psychology, and consciousness expansion. The Shift Network hosts the annual Psychedelic Healing Summit and offers online courses on psilocybin science, therapeutic applications, facilitator selection, and the history and renaissance of psychedelic healing.
